The Medical Representative is responsible for promoting and selling pharmaceutical products to doctors, hospitals, clinics, and healthcare professionals. The role focuses on building strong relationships, increasing product awareness, and achieving assigned sales targets while adhering to ethical and regulatory standards.
---
Key Responsibilities
Sales & Promotion
Promote company products to doctors, pharmacists, hospitals, and healthcare professionals.
Achieve and exceed assigned sales targets within the designated territory.
Conduct regular field visits and product presentations.
Organize and participate in medical camps, CMEs, and promotional events.
Relationship Management
Build and maintain strong professional relationships with doctors and healthcare staff.
Address customer queries and provide accurate product information.
Collect feedback on product performance and market needs.
Market Intelligence
Monitor competitor activities and market trends.
Provide regular market feedback and reports to management.
Identify new business opportunities and potential clients.
Reporting & Compliance
Maintain daily call reports, expense reports, and sales documentation.
Ensure compliance with company policies, industry regulations, and ethical standards.
Follow all legal and safety guidelines during field activities.
